在Hadoop体系架构中HBase与其他组成部分的联系
时间: 2023-06-02 12:07:19 浏览: 104
HBase是Hadoop生态系统中的一个组件,它是一个分布式的非关系型数据库,可与其他Hadoop组件(如HDFS、MapReduce)结合使用,使其更有效地处理数据。HBase存储大量的非结构化数据,并具备实时读写的能力。它可以作为Hadoop生态系统中的一种NoSQL数据库来存储数据,而不需要使用传统的关系数据库。这使得Hadoop处理数据时更加高效和灵活。
相关问题
hbase在hadoop体系结构中的角色
HBase是Hadoop生态系统中的一个分布式NoSQL数据库,其主要的角色是提供一种高可靠性、高可扩展性、高性能的数据存储和访问解决方案。
在Hadoop体系结构中,HBase通常作为数据存储层的一个组件,被用于存储半结构化和非结构化数据,例如日志数据、用户行为数据等。HBase的数据存储方式类似于一个分布式的哈希表,它将数据分片存储在不同的节点上,并且提供了快速的数据读写能力。
HBase的数据存储和访问基于HDFS,它利用HDFS的高可靠性和高可用性特点,确保了数据的可靠性和高可用性。同时,HBase还提供了对数据的高效查询和分析能力,其支持基于列族的数据存储和检索,以及基于主键的数据访问。
总之,HBase在Hadoop体系结构中的角色是作为数据存储层的一个组件,为上层的数据处理和分析提供了高可靠性、高可扩展性、高性能的数据存储和访问解决方案。
HBase在Hadoop体系结构中的角色
HBase是Hadoop生态系统中的一个分布式NoSQL数据库,其主要的角色是提供一种高可靠性、高可扩展性、高性能的数据存储和访问解决方案。
在Hadoop体系结构中,HBase通常作为数据存储层的一个组件,被用于存储半结构化和非结构化数据,例如日志数据、用户行为数据等。HBase的数据存储方式类似于一个分布式的哈希表,它将数据分片存储在不同的节点上,并且提供了快速的数据读写能力。
HBase的数据存储和访问基于HDFS,它利用HDFS的高可靠性和高可用性特点,确保了数据的可靠性和高可用性。同时,HBase还提供了对数据的高效查询和分析能力,其支持基于列族的数据存储和检索,以及基于主键的数据访问。
总之,HBase在Hadoop体系结构中的角色是作为数据存储层的一个组件,为上层的数据处理和分析提供了高可靠性、高可扩展性、高性能的数据存储和访问解决方案。